India and Oman begins Eastern Bridge-VI Air Exercise in Jodhpur

The Indian Air Force (IAF) and Royal Air Force of Oman (RAFO) have organised bilateral air exercise named Eastern Bridge-VI from February 21 to 25, 2022 at Air Force Station Jodhpur in Rajasthan. The exercise named Eastern Bridge-VI is in its sixth edition. The exercise will provide an opportunity to enhance operational capability and interoperability between the two Air Forces.

Ramgarh Vishdhari has got Centre nod to become 4th tiger reserve of Rajasthan

Ramgarh Vishdhari Wildlife Sanctuary received all clearances to become the Rajasthan’s fourth and country’s 52nd tiger reserve. Daily Current Affairs Quiz 2021 The tigers were believed to have disappeared from the sanctuary in 1999. Ramgarh Vishdhari wildlife sanctuary to become the 4th Tiger reserve of Rajasthan

The National Tiger Conservation Authority (NTCA) granted a nod to the Ramgarh Vishdhari wildlife sanctuary to become the 4th Tiger reserve of Rajasthan.
